Which statement accurately describes how Outlook relies on server infrastructure?

Explanation:
Outlook relies on a server-based mailbox to function across devices, not just local storage. In most setups, Outlook connects to a server such as an Exchange server or a cloud service like Microsoft 365. The server handles mail routing, calendar sharing, contacts, and policy enforcement, while Outlook provides the user interface to view and manage that data. This setup enables real-time syncing, access from multiple devices, and consistent settings because the data lives on the server (with an offline copy stored locally for fast access).
